Achoimre:Pneumatic Artificial Muscle (PAM) is a type of actuator that similar to human muscle. The PAM is used for converting pneumatic power to pulling force and enentually causing movements of mechanism. One of the potential usages of the PAM is load-lifting applications. In order to enhance the application of PAM, it is necessary to understand the basis of PAM development. But, only few numbers of study discuss the parameters and suitability of braided mesh with bladder that could enhance the PAM performance. To solve this problem, this study more focused on investigating the compatibility of braided mesh with bladder and also relationship of lenght and diameter bladder.
